Former Nike logistics head joins Starboard Alliance

Jun 19, 2009 Logistics

ohn Isbell, a 31-year veteran of Nike, has joined supply chain and logistics consulting services firm Starboard Alliance Co. as vice president.
  

For the past 11 years, Isbell helped Nike develop its strategic direction and led the global management of the sporting goods company’s logistics services providers responsible for origin consolidation, ocean and air transport of both in-line and product samples, as well as supply chain security and claims management.

His supply chain redesign is credited for reducing Nike’s delivery spend, improving customer delivery performance, reducing order-to-cash cycles, and creating multiple supply chains for seasonal, auto replenishment and consumer-direct products.

Isbell is also known throughout the shipping industry for his innovate concepts in global contracts for origin consolidation, ocean freight, air cargo and small package shipments.

In addition, he has served in board positions with both The Waterfront Coalition and Coalition for Responsible Transportation as an industry advocate for improvements to the U.S. multimodal transportation network.

Manzanita, Ore-based Starboard Alliance, founded by Monica Isbell in 2003, offers a range of supply chain and logistics consulting services to clients in four primary sectors: importers and exporters, logistics service providers, ports, and government entities.
